D'Angelo Already Working On New Album
. In an interview with Rolling Stone, D'Angelo revealed that "What I'm working on now is like a companion piece. I hope people receive it that way. It's part of the same vision." Judging by how many songs D'Angelo recorded in the decade plus spanning between Black Messiah and his 2000 LP Voodoo, it seems likely that some of the outtakes from last year's album could be included on this "companion piece."
